FirefoxPolicies.pkg.recipe.yaml

Basics

Last refresh 2025-04-04 01:50:51
Desciption Downloads Firefox disk image and builds a package, copying your 'distribution/policies.json' file into the application bundle. Adapted from Greg Neagle's FirefoxAutoconfig.pkg recipe. Create a 'distribution' directory in the same directory as the recipe and copy your policies.json file there. Firefox versions below 60 are not supported by this recipe. ORG_NAME is inserted into the pkg name to distinguish a vanilla "Firefox-60.0.pkg" from "Firefox_PretendCo-60.0.pkg". You might consider setting a unique PKG_ID to differentiate your org's "flavor" of Firefox. Values for RELEASE correspond to directories here: http://download-origin.cdn.mozilla.net/pub/mozilla.org/firefox/releases/ Some useful values are: 'latest', 'latest-10.0esr', 'latest-esr', 'latest-3.6', 'latest-beta' LOCALE corresponds to directories at http://download-origin.cdn.mozilla.net/pub/mozilla.org/firefox/releases/$FIREFOX_BUILD/mac/ Examples include 'en_GB', 'en-US', 'de', 'ja-JP-mac', 'sv-SE', and 'zh-TW' No idea if all Firefox builds are available in all the same localizations, so you may need to verify that any particular combination is offered."
Identifier com.github.neilmartin83.pkg.FirefoxPolicies
Parent Recipes com.github.autopkg.download.firefox-rc-en_US
Child Recipes jazzace-recipes/Mozilla/FirefoxPolicies.ds.recipe
wardsparadox-recipes/Mozilla/FirefoxPolicies.munki.recipe
First commit 2025-01-31 11:09:03 +0000
Latest commit 2025-03-10 20:20:19 +0000
Score 0.10

Warnings

The following recipes have duplicate NAMEs (firefox.pkg):